It has been a long a hard preseason and everyone was really keen to kick the season off on a good note and that’s what the girls did.
It was going to be tough game against Baw Baw especially at their home ground but we went into the game with confidence that we’d had a solid preseason. During the week Jess Jacobs pulled out due to injury which was very disappointing as Jess was really training well and Shan had a sore foot that flared up Thursday night so we weren’t at full strength going into the game.
Baw Baw hit the scoreboard first after we had good control of the game which sparked the Tas & Tasma show and we went into ½ time 4-1 up. In the 2nd half we created a lot of opportunities but couldn’t put the ball in the back of the net and Baw Baw started to fight back and scored to make it 4-2. During this period we still had control of the game but it was becoming tighter and we really needed to score to finish Baw Baw off. Tas scored her 3rd goal for the game after some nice build up through the midfield to seal the victory with 10 minutes to go.
Congratulations to Tasma, Katelyn Waring, Paige and Taryn for their first game in the 1sts
Everyone played well and was good team effort.
Goal scorers 3 Tamsin Nelson 2 Tasma Ritchie
